WebMartin is the most frequent surname in France and one of the most frequent surnames in Wallonia. English: variant of Marton. Irish: Anglicized form of Gaelic Ó Mártain ‘descendant of Martin’ (compare 1 above). Otherwise a shortened form of Gilmartin or McMartin; sometimes also spelled Martyn. View more facts for Martin. WebThe Martin family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Martin families were found in USA in 1880. In 1891 there were 11,222 Martin families living in London. This was about 18% of all the recorded Martin's in United Kingdom. London had the highest population of Martin families in 1891. WebRoman family name that was derived either from Mars, the name of the Roman god of War, or else from the Latin root mas, maris meaning "male". Gaius Marius was a famous Roman consul of the 2nd century BC. Since the start of the Christian era, it has occasionally been used as a masculine form of Maria. Martin is a common given and family name in many languages. In some languages, and as a given name, it comes from the Latin name Martinus, which is a late derived form of the name of the Roman god Mars, the protective godhead of the Latins (and therefore the god of warring). cgenngo swithWebMartin may either be a surname or given name.
